Grizzlies trade Speights to CLE 

Post#1 » by BD12 » Tue Jan 22, 2013 2:04 pm

Marc J. Spears ‏@SpearsNBAYahoo
Grizzlies trade Speights, Selby and pick to Cavs for Lauer, source said.


Ken Berger ‏@KBergCBS
League source confirms Grizzlies agree to send Marreese Speights, Josh Selby to Cavs for Jon Leuer. There is a pick involved in deal.


Marc J. Spears ‏@SpearsNBAYahoo
Cavaliers also get a second round pick in trade.


Ken Berger ‏@KBergCBS
The trade saves the Grizzlies about $4M, pushing them under the tax line and eliminating financial need to move Rudy Gay this season.


Confirmed deal: The Grizzlies would send big man Marreese Speights, guard Wayne Ellington and guard Josh Selby to the Cavs for big man Jon Leuer. There are also believed to be a future draft pick involved in the deal.
